> >AFAIK, the standard does not define
> >the meaning of "machine representable number".
> 
> I think the normal English definition applies (as it generally does 
> when there is a normal English meaning and there isn't an overriding 
> technical definition in the standard).  Namely...
> 
> I would say that "machine representable number" means a number that the 
> machine can represent.
> 
> Note that this is definitely not the same thing as a "model number". 
> The standard does define what a model number is, and it distinguishes 
> model numbers from machine representable numbers.  (Which isn't to say 
> that there might not be places where it gets it wrong, but the 
> distinction is made).
> 

Yes, that's the interpretation that Tobi and I want to make.
nearest(0.,1.) should return a subnormal number if that is the 
nearest "machine representable number".  I'm somewhat surprised 
that standard did not state "processor-dependent representable
number" in the sense of a Fortran processor.  Afterall, a
Fortran processor does not need to be tied to a "machine".
